前提
pythonでtypehint で、変数の型を上書きする方法(typescriptでのasのような)があれば、教えてください。
コードサンプル
下記のtypescriptのas にあたる、pythonの構文を教えていただきたいです。
typescript
function multiTypeFunction(range:number):string|number { if (1<range){ return 'ichi' } else { return 1 }}let result = multiTypeFunction(0) as number
python
def multiTypeFunction(range: int) ->str | int : if (1 < range): return 'ichi' else: return 1 result = multiTypeFunction(0) as int

0 コメント